Wednesday, September 08, 2004

Breslan Fallout?

Buried at the bottom of a news item today,
In new signs that U.S. complaints about Iran may be having an impact, German Chancellor Gerhard Schroeder on Wednesday called Tehran's nuclear activities "extremely alarming" and Russia reported new delays in construction of an Iranian nuclear facility at Bushehr.
Gee, I wonder why?


